If will not hamper, explain please step by step as you decided it. I have the same problem.

If you're on a Linux or Unix client (or server), then cd into your nsr/ res directory, then type

nsradmin -d nsrladb

then type "vi" and this will give you a menu which you can scroll through, so just go to the peer you want to delete and select the delete menu item. If this is on Windows, then I have no idea. On Windows clients, I simply remove NetWorker, then remove the networker folder where the res directory resides, then reinstall the NetWorker client.
